Rumah  >  Artikel  >  pangkalan data  >  Bagaimanakah saya boleh menukar baris menjadi satu lajur dalam MySQL?

Bagaimanakah saya boleh menukar baris menjadi satu lajur dalam MySQL?

Linda Hamilton
Linda Hamiltonasal
2024-10-28 11:53:14479semak imbas

How can I convert rows into a single column in MySQL?

MySQL: Menukar Baris menjadi Lajur Tunggal

Dalam MySQL, adalah mungkin untuk mengubah baris menjadi satu lajur menggunakan fungsi GROUP_CONCAT. Walau bagaimanapun, pemindahan terus keseluruhan set hasil bukanlah proses automatik.

Untuk mencipta satu lajur daripada baris, anda boleh menggunakan fungsi GROUP_CONCAT:

SELECT GROUP_CONCAT(column_name) FROM table_name;

Walau bagaimanapun, adalah penting untuk ambil perhatian bahawa pendekatan ini hanya menukar lajur tertentu, bukan keseluruhan set hasil.

Untuk mencapai transposisi penuh baris ke dalam lajur, pertanyaan tersuai atau pendekatan berasaskan aplikasi diperlukan. Sumber berikut menyediakan panduan terperinci tentang membuat pertanyaan kompleks untuk transposisi baris-ke-lajur:

http://www.artfulsoftware.com/infotree/queries.php#78

Atas ialah kandungan terperinci Bagaimanakah saya boleh menukar baris menjadi satu lajur dalam MySQL?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n